YN68 AVY is a 2018 Nissan Cabstar in White with a 2,953c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.

Across all 2018 Nissan Cabstar models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.7% with a typical mileage of 49,653 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Nissan Cabstar f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 27,729 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YN68 AVY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Cabstar typ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 8 years old, this Nissan Cabstar is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
